关键词

视频流 播放

在 Vue 中如何播放 RTSP 视频流?

Vue 是一种渐进式的 JavaScript 框架,它可以帮助开发者快速构建用户界面。Vue 可以用来构建单页应用程序,也可以用来构建复杂的用户界面。本文将介绍如何在 Vue 中播放 RTSP 视频流。

1. 使用 HTML5 video 标签

使用 HTML5 video 标签是在 Vue 中播放 RTSP 视频流最简单的方法。HTML5 video 标签可以直接接受 RTSP 视频流,无需任何额外的插件或第三方库。只需在 Vue 组件中添加一个 video 标签,将 RTSP 视频流的 URL 作为 src 属性即可:

<video src="rtsp://example.com/stream.mp4"></video>

如果你想在 Vue 中添加更多的视频控制选项,你可以使用 HTML5 video 标签的各种属性,比如 autoplay、controls、loop 等。

2. 使用第三方库

如果你需要在 Vue 中实现更多的视频播放功能,你可以使用第三方库,比如 video.js 。Video.js 是一个开源的 HTML5 视频播放器,它可以让你在 Vue 中轻松实现视频播放、控制、缩放等功能。

要在 Vue 中使用 video.js,你需要先安装它:

npm install video.js --save

在 Vue 组件中引入它:

import videojs from 'video.js'

你可以在组件中创建一个 video.js 的实例,并将 RTSP 视频流的 URL 作为实例的 src 属性:

let player = videojs('my-player', {
  src: 'rtsp://example.com/stream.mp4',
  controls: true
});

这样,你就可以在 Vue 中使用 video.js 来播放 RTSP 视频流了。

3. 使用 Vue Video Player

Vue Video Player 是一个开源的 HTML5 视频播放器,它可以帮助你在 Vue 中轻松播放 RTSP 视频流。Vue Video Player 支持多种视频格式,包括 RTSP、HLS、MP4 等,并支持自定义控件、视频截图、更改播放速度等功能。

要在 Vue 中使用 Vue Video Player,你需要先安装它:

npm install vue-video-player --save

在 Vue 组件中引入它:

import VideoPlayer from 'vue-video-player'

你可以在组件中创建一个 VideoPlayer 的实例,并将 RTSP 视频流的 URL 作为实例的 src 属性:

let player = new VideoPlayer({
  src: 'rtsp://example.com/stream.mp4',
  controls: true
});

这样,你就可以在 Vue 中使用 Vue Video Player 来播放 RTSP 视频流了。

结论

本文介绍了如何在 Vue 中播放 RTSP 视频流。你可以使用 HTML5 video 标签,也可以使用第三方库,比如 video.js 或 Vue Video Player 来实现更多的视频播放功能。无论你选择哪种方式,都可以让你在 Vue 中轻松播放 RTSP 视频流。

本文链接:http://task.lmcjl.com/news/833.html

展开阅读全文